Construction and Design

The FluidoSurge-X 392 is a floor-standing experimental flume with a 1 m experimental section of 50 x 200 mm (W x H) cross section. Side walls are tempered glass for unobstructed observation. Three evenly spaced threaded holes on the channel bottom provide secure model mounting. All water-contact components are fabricated from corrosion-resistant materials, stainless steel and glass reinforced plastic. The flow-optimised inlet element minimises turbulence at the entry to the experimental section. Inclination is smoothly adjustable from -0.5% to +3% and is read via a magnetic inclinometer with a -90° to +90° range. The closed water circuit includes a 100 L sump tank, a pump rated at 0.37 kW with 80 LPM max. flow rate and 15 m head at 2850 rpm, and a rotameter covering 0.8 to 70 LPM with manual flow adjustment.


Software

FX 392, Optional

Developed in the LabVIEW environment, operates on Windows. Provides data acquisition, processing, and reporting. Capabilities: precise measurement and calculation, data tabulation and graphing, image capture, and CSV report generation containing all measured and calculated data including graphs.
